"Despite heroic efforts... we could still lose these extraordinary butterflies by not taking bolder action," warned one conservationist.Wildlife conservationists sounded the alarm Wednesday as an annual count of monarch butterflies revealed a sharp decline in the number of the iconic insects hibernating in Mexican forests, stoking renewed fears of their extinction.

"Despite heroic efforts to save monarchs by planting milkweed, we could still lose these extraordinary butterflies by not taking bolder action," Tierra Curry, a senior scientist at the Center for Biological Diversity , said in a"Monarchs were once incredibly common," she added."Now they're the face of the extinction crisis as U.S. populations crash amid habitat loss and the climate meltdown."Renowned for its epic annual migrations from the northern U.S.

"It is not just about conserving a species, it's also about conserving a unique migratory phenomenon in nature,"WWF Mexico general director Jorge Rickards."Monarchs contribute to healthy and diverse terrestrial ecosystems across North America as they carry pollen from one plant to another." "With 80% of agricultural food production depending on pollinators like monarchs, when people help the species, we are also helping ourselves," he added.
